osmos Bipinnatus, also known as the Garden Cosmos or Mexican Aster, is a delightful annual flower that will brighten up any garden with its vibrant blooms. The Seashells Mix variety features fully double, tufted flowers in a gorgeous blend of colors including white, pink, rose, and crimson.

These bushy, branching plants grow 3-4 feet tall, making them ideal for border plantings or cutting gardens. The ferny foliage provides a lovely backdrop for the showy flower heads that resemble seashells or pom-poms. Cosmos are very easy to grow from seed and will bloom abundantly from summer until the first frost if deadheaded regularly.

To grow:

  • Sow seeds directly in the garden after danger of last frost
  • Plant 1/4 inch deep and 12-18 inches apart
  • Prefers full sun and well-drained soil
  • Water seeds regularly until established

Cosmos make long-lasting cut flowers and also attract bees, butterflies, and other pollinators to the garden. Their cheerful blooms are perfect for cottage gardens, meadows, and naturalized areas. This delightful mixture will provide armloads of flowers for bouquets all season long.

Plant Type: Annual Flower Mature Height: 3-4 feet
Bloom Time: Summer to Frost Sun Exposure: Full Sun
